    Incarnate Exp?

    1.5 million iXP for Judgment and Interface.
    2.5 million iXP for Destiny and Lore.

    once the first slot opens up, it goes directly towards second slot. So first judgment opens up, then it automatically starts working towards lore.

  23. Quote:
    Originally Posted by Narkor View Post
    I did read Dechs' guide, multiple times, even. But it doesn't really help on the side of 'farming'. The general advice is gold, but I am looking into creating a more than capable farmer (hopefully out of an EAT), which the guide does not touch.
    Sorry. His guide is the best advice I can find on methodology of taking out large spawns consistantly with a warshade. Peacebringers afaik do not shine in this arena. The knockback kind of negates it.

    Quote:
    And, in case it didn't go through; no matter how much I pump double mires, and even sometimes inspirations, my warshade cannot even come close in terms of capabilities to my widow, or even my scrappers (who are not even 50 yet, nor do they have any IOs).
    No matter how much influence, and experience you have, you are trying to take a niche AT that excels in certain situations, and transfer that utility to a farming situation. If you want a farmer, a pure, hardcore farmer that can handle +4/8 roll a FA brute or tank. The consistant taunt aura is what makes these toons the best farmers. Scrappers, although cappable, do not do it with the ease of the brute or tank.

    In the end, you can farm with anything, even an emp, although the pace may make you feel like killing yourself. If you want a niche toon that can do it, fine, but if you want to compete with the hardcore farm builds, gfl.

    [edit]Also, any reason you need to farm at +4? I can see it if you are pling, but farming? +2 is usually optimal. +3 if you are lvl shifted.[edit]

    Quote:
    I'm not only talking about damage-wise, but also the capacities to solo and help teams. I've seriously begun wondering if the kheldians in general aren't just being overshadowed by the other archetypes.
    Kelds are well known to fill in the holes a team may, or may not have. Blasts, tank, control or just general *** kicking, a warshade need not fear being overshadowed. If you are suggesting they should be balanced against a few builds that can handle the most hostile situations at +4/8 you are bound to be disappointed.

    Either way, glhf. If it has to be an EAT, my suggestion would be a crab, but its your $15.
